服务器网站启动失败怎么办啊?

分析原因
当服务器网站启动失败时,首先要分析导致失败的原因,以下是一些常见的原因:
-
系统配置错误:服务器操作系统或应用程序配置不当,导致无法正常启动。
-
网络问题:服务器与客户端之间的网络连接不稳定或中断,导致无法访问网站。
-
资源不足:服务器硬件资源(如CPU、内存、磁盘空间等)不足,无法满足网站运行需求。
-
程序错误:网站程序存在bug或代码错误,导致无法正常运行。
-
权限问题:服务器权限设置不正确,导致无法访问相关文件或目录。
解决方法
针对以上原因,以下是一些解决方法:

-
检查系统配置:确保服务器操作系统和应用程序配置正确,如防火墙、端口设置等。
-
检查网络连接:确认服务器与客户端之间的网络连接稳定,排除网络故障。
-
检查资源:查看服务器硬件资源使用情况,确保满足网站运行需求,如需提高性能,可考虑升级硬件或优化配置。
-
修复程序错误:检查网站程序代码,修复bug或错误,可通过调试工具或日志分析定位问题。
-
修改权限设置:确保服务器权限设置正确,允许访问相关文件和目录。
具体操作步骤
-
检查系统日志:查看服务器系统日志,了解启动失败的具体原因。
-
检查网络连接:使用ping命令测试服务器与客户端之间的网络连接。
-
检查资源使用情况:使用top、htop等工具查看服务器资源使用情况。

-
检查网站程序:检查网站程序代码,修复bug或错误。
-
修改权限设置:根据需要修改服务器权限设置,确保访问相关文件和目录。
相关问答FAQs
Q1:服务器网站启动失败,如何检查系统日志?
A1:在服务器上,可以使用以下命令查看系统日志:
- Linux:
tail f /var/log/syslog - Windows:
eventvwr.msc
Q2:服务器网站启动失败,如何检查网络连接?
A2:在服务器上,可以使用以下命令检查网络连接:
- Linux:
ping IP地址 - Windows:
ping IP地址
通过以上方法,您可以有效地解决服务器网站启动失败的问题,在实际操作过程中,如遇到复杂问题,建议寻求专业技术人员帮助。
